    Little Tavern

    Date Established
    Location
    1927
    Louisville, Kentucky

    Description
    The first Little Tavern hamburger restaurant opened March 24, 1927, in Louisville, Kentucky, by Harry F. Duncan. At the height of the chain, there were almost 50 locations. From 1928 to 1931, Little Taverns resembled the same castle design closely as White Castles and White Towers. Duncan sold the chain in 1981 and had troubles in the 1990s and the last restaurant closed on April 29, 2008.
